Program Description

Students who pursue a minor in geographic information sciences will be ready to claim jobs in a global atmosphere where geographic knowledge is rapidly becoming more important to the interaction of humans with the environment. You'll learn to use the latest hardware and software and the newest research methods to build marketable skills in mapping, aerial photo, satellite image interpretation and Geographic Information Science (GIS).
